About the Role


The Clinical Research Fellow will be a key member of a busy and large academic medical oncology unit based at the Clayton campus of Monash Health.

The Fellow will provide clinical care to patients enrolled on phase I, phase II and phase III cancer clinical trials across all tumour streams.

Trials clinics for all tumour types will be conducted daily at MHTP, at which the Fellow will be expected to actively participate.

The Fellow will also be expected to engage in translational research with opportunities for writing manuscripts, involvement in projects and attendance at national and international conferences.

The Fellow will also be supported in developing protocols and is expected to fully work up at least one new proposal for an investigator initiated trial.

The Fellow will assist with administration regarding collection and presentation of metrics for the Clinical Trials Unit.

The Fellow will participate in the afterhours on call service as first on call.

The on-call role is largely telephone based, but there is an infrequent need for call back to attend high acuity patients at the Moorabbin campus or occasionally the Emergency Department at Clayton campus.

Participation at clinical meetings will include case presentations, journal article reviews and topic presentations.
